Brynn Grant is in her second tenure at the Savannah Economic Development Authority (SEDA) and is happy to return home to south Georgia, which is where she grew up in nearby Hinesville. It has been a long road back, but Grant details her work from the origins of the Savannah Music Festival to her current position with World Trade Center Savannah.
